WebMay 14, 2024 · Evolution involves two interrelated phenomena: adaptation and speciation. In adaptation, over the course of time, species modify their phenotypes in ways that permit them to succeed in their environment. WebEvidence Against Evolutionism From Molecular Biology. Introduction. When the theory of evolution was first proposed by Charles Darwin (his Origin of Species was published in 1859), scientists knew very little about the makeup of the living cell. They assumed it to be a relatively simple blob of protoplasm.

WebEvolution Explains the Origin of Life. It is a common misunderstanding that evolution includes an explanation of life’s origins. Some of the theory’s critics complain that it cannot explain the origin of life. The theory does not try to explain the origin of life. In his book, Darwin describes how organisms evolve over ... hotstar specials special ops 1.5WebEvidence for large-scale evolution ( macroevolution) comes from anatomy and embryology, molecular biology, biogeography, and fossils. Similar anatomy found in different species may be homologous (shared due to ancestry) or analogous (shared due to similar selective pressures).
